Constructors' Championship

It's not all about the drivers' title: McLaren have run away with the constructors' gong but the team, with a 40-point lead over their rivals, will be hoping to seal second place during this event. George Russell can help them achieve that from the front row, and Kimi Antonelli will begin immediately after Verstappen.

Short Race Importance

Alright, just over twenty minutes remaining until the sprint race gets under way. Unless something goes wrong, its main importance is as an indication of what is to come, instead of highly important in its itself, with only eight points awarded to the winner. However, second place here was enough for Verstappen to claim the title in a prior season.
